The Chicago Bulls have indicated a clear direction thus far with their off-season moves. It started by trading Alex Caruso for guard Josh Giddey from Oklahoma City. Giddey is 21 years old and entering his fourth season. Next came drafting 19-year-old Matas Buzelis 11th overall. Now their first big move of free agency was signing 24-year-old center Jalen Smith. If it wasn’t obvious before, there is no longer any confusion that the Bulls are enacting a youth movement. That leaves the status of 34-year-old star DeMar DeRozan up in the air.
